The librarian from the black lagoon / story by Mike Thaler ; pictures by Jared Lee.
Today our class is going to the library. We heard some really scary things about the librarian! Does she really laminate kids for whispering?

Mike Thaler was born in Los Angeles in 1936. After moving to New York City, he started his professional career drawing cartoons for adults in 1960. A children's book editor saw one of these cartoons and encouraged Mike to write for children. Since then, Mike has written over 140 childrenâs books and has become known as Americaâs ?Riddle King.â Mike says that writing and riddles are a powerful way to stimulate a childâs interest in learning and creating. He is an award-winning author and illustrator and has been called ?one of the most creative people in childrenâs literature.â Mike currently lives in Canby, Oregon.
Jared Lee has illustrated more than 100 books for young readers. He has received awards from the Society of Illustrators, the Martha Kinney Cooper Ohioana Library Association, the National Cartoonists Society, and others. He lives in Ohio with his wife and a menagerie of dogs, cats, ponies, ducks, and a few unknown creatures.
